Division of Dramatic Art, Wits School of Arts
The Wits School of Arts is the top interdisciplinary school of arts in Africa. We provide a showcase for some of Africa’s most significant academic and artistic talent. Dramatic Art is one of many leading academic and professional training programmes offered at WSOA. The Division of Dramatic Art offers a comprehensive, inter-disciplinary dramatic art undergraduate degree with a range of specialisations that can be further explored in our postgraduate degrees.

• Bachelor of Arts in Dramatic Art (BADA)
Performance Studies, Television & Film Studies, Design Studies, Movement/Dance/Physical Theatre, Applied Drama and Theatre Studies (including drama therapy, community-based theatre, educational drama), Directing Studies, Performing Arts Management, Writing for Performance, Academic Studies

• Bachelor of Arts (Honours) Drama and Film (BA Honours)
Performance Studies, Television & Film Studies, Design Studies, Movement/Dance/Physical Theatre, Applied Drama and Theatre Studies (including drama therapy, community-based theatre, educational drama), Directing Studies, Performing Arts Management, Writing for Performance, Film Studies: Black Cinema, African Cinema, Youth and Hollywood Cinema, Media Studies: Reading the News, Gender and Performance Studies
Including the International All Africa Drama for Life Programme (www.dramaforlife.co.za)

• Master of Arts in Dramatic Art (MADA)
Theatre Studies and Performance Theory, Drama in Education, Theatre as Activism, Education and Therapy, Directing (including Installations and Choreography), Performance Laboratory, Film Studies: Representations of Identity, Construction of Nationhood and the Cinema, Research Report, Dissertation and Creative Research Project

Including the International All Africa Drama for Life Programme (www.dramaforlife.co.za)
